The cheapest way to get from Montreal to Albuquerque is to bus which costs $250 - $650 and takes 2 days 5h.
The fastest way to get from Montreal to Albuquerque is to fly which takes 11h 1m and costs $200 - $1,000.
No, there is no direct bus from Montreal to Albuquerque station. However, there are services departing from Montreal and arriving at Albuquerque Bus Station via Port Authority Bus Terminal and St Louis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2 days 5h.
No, there is no direct train from Montreal station to Albuquerque. However, there are services departing from Montreal Central Station and arriving at Albuquerque Alvarado Transportation Center via Schenectady and Chicago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2 days 2h.
The distance between Montreal and Albuquerque is 1887 miles. The road distance is 2124.5 miles.
The best way to get from Montreal to Albuquerque without a car is to bus which takes 2 days 5h and costs $250 - $650.
It takes approximately 11h 1m to get from Montreal to Albuquerque, including transfers.
Montreal to Albuquerque b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Montreal station.
Montreal to Albuquerque train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Montreal Central Station.
The best way to get from Montreal to Albuquerque is to fly which takes 11h 1m and costs $200 - $1,000. Alternatively, you can train via Toronto, which costs $240 - $750 and takes 43h 30m, you could also bus, which costs $250 - $650 and takes 2 days 5h.
